The Challenge: Compare leading NBFCs to identify the strongest investment opportunity based on financial health, growth prospects, and operational efficiency.
Companies Compared: Bajaj Finance, M&M Financial, Shriram Finance, L&T Finance, PNB Housing
| Key Ratio | Bajaj Finance | M&M Financial | Shriram Finance | Leader |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| ROE (%) | 21.8 | 15.2 | 17.1 | Bajaj Finance |
| Gross NPA Ratio (%) | 1.92 | 3.45 | 4.12 | Bajaj Finance |
| Net Interest Margin (%) | 9.8 | 6.7 | 7.2 | Bajaj Finance |
| AUM Growth Rate (%) | 28.5 | 18.7 | 22.1 | Bajaj Finance |
| Finmagine Score | 9.2 | 7.8 | 8.1 | Bajaj Finance |
The Result: Bajaj Finance emerges as the clear leader across all key NBFC metrics, demonstrating superior profitability, asset quality, operational efficiency, and growth - making it the strongest investment candidate in the peer group.
